Mary Joan Dukesherer

July 20, 1928 — May 29, 2021

On May 29, 2021, our dear Mary Joan Dukesherer entered the gates of heaven. She was preceded in death by her husband, Stanley John Dukesherer, a son, David Joseph Dukesherer, and twin daughters, Joan and Marian.

Mary was born in Detroit, Michigan on July 20, 1928. She was the second of four children born to Lloyd and Margaret Thompson. Mary grew up caring for her siblings, John, Dolores and Margaret, and devoting her life to her Catholic faith. She attended Nazareth College and her roommate soon introduced her to Stan, a friend from her roommate’s hometown, Benton Harbor, Michigan. Mary and Stanley were married on September 18, 1948.

After their first year of marriage Mary and Stan moved cross country to California with their son, John, in 1950. They settled in Westchester where they were blessed with six more sons (Thomas, Daniel, David, Kevin, Philip and Paul), and three daughters (Christine) and twins who died at childbirth (Joan and Marian). Mary dedicated her life to raising her family.

In 1976, after living in Puerto Rico for three years, the Dukesherer family moved to San Pedro. Mary continued serving God by teaching Catechism at Mary Star of the Sea Church. Mary loved babies, and was an amazing grandmother to her 24 grandchildren and 25 great grandchildren. She will always be remembered for her long-winded conversations and many cups of tea with her family and friends. Mary was an incredible role model and leaves us with many, many happy memories which we will dearly cherish.
